Output 261403dfa9595a0c585ea331212b574de044397435926e961f6f873a40dc0ece:15

value
86100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b50b82be5fec9ace635a97edbc778775295b139 OP_EQUAL
address
3EPeYh5TJYquZsro46oyu6uATYGBTPYZ78
transaction
261403dfa9595a0c585ea331212b574de044397435926e961f6f873a40dc0ece
spent
true